Al Murphy – Flagging

The W+K London walls are currently adorned with with the art of illustrator Al Murphy.

For his latest project, ‘Flagging’, Al has brought to life a selection of sketches and doodles, turning them into hand stitched banners, cut from the finest felt Wood Green’s prestigious The Mall shopping centre had to offer. Each design is a strictly limited edition of ten.

According to the artist, hours and hours were spent painstakingly waiting for someone else to do all the stitching, during which time, Al watched television and checked Facebook and things like that.

Forever Curious window

Being curious and creative is important to us. With cuts to school budgets, children aren’t getting the chance to be as creative as they could be. That’s where Forever Curious comes in.

Each year we invite 90 local school children to get creative with some W+K volunteers. This year’s workshop was called My Creative Spark and included the creation of some imaginary worlds. Each planet in the magical universe has two sides; one made by a child, the other by a W+K buddy. They’ve come together to make a world where anything is possible.
